引言
在软件行业,对软件进行有效评估是一项至关重要的任务。打分制作为一种常见的评估方法,被广泛应用于软件质量保证、产品比较和用户评价等领域。本文将深入解析打分制的原理、应用场景以及如何构建一个有效的打分体系。
打分制的定义与原理
定义
打分制是一种通过量化指标对软件进行评价的方法。它将软件的各个方面转化为具体的分数,从而得出一个综合评分,用以反映软件的整体质量。
原理
打分制的基本原理是将软件的各个功能、性能、用户体验等维度进行分解,并设定相应的评分标准。通过对比实际表现与标准,计算出每个维度的得分,最终汇总得到总分。
打分制的应用场景
软件质量保证
在软件开发过程中,打分制可以用于评估软件的质量,确保其满足预定的标准和要求。
产品比较
在众多软件产品中,打分制可以帮助用户快速了解不同产品的优劣势,做出更明智的选择。
用户评价
用户可以通过打分制对软件进行评价,为其他用户提供参考。
构建有效的打分体系
确定评分维度
首先,需要明确软件评估的各个维度,如功能完整性、性能、用户体验、安全性等。
设定评分标准
针对每个评分维度,设定具体的评分标准。例如,功能完整性可以按照功能的数量、功能的完善程度等进行评分。
分数分配
根据评分标准,将总分分配到各个维度。例如,如果软件有10个功能,每个功能可以分配10分。
评分方法
常见的评分方法包括:
- 五分制:将每个维度分为五个等级,分别对应不同的分数。
- 百分制:将每个维度分为100分,根据实际表现进行评分。
- 等级制:将每个维度分为若干等级,如优秀、良好、一般、较差、差。
数据收集与分析
收集软件的实际表现数据,如性能测试结果、用户反馈等,并根据评分标准进行评分。
评分结果应用
根据评分结果,对软件进行改进或推荐给用户。
打分制的优势与局限性
优势
- 客观性:打分制基于量化指标,减少了主观因素的影响。
- 可比性:不同软件可以通过打分制进行直接比较。
- 透明性:评分标准和过程公开,用户可以了解评分依据。
局限性
- 指标选取:评分维度的选取可能存在主观性。
- 数据质量:评分结果依赖于数据的准确性。
- 动态变化:软件的功能和性能会随时间变化,评分结果可能滞后。
结论
打分制是一种有效的软件评估方法,可以帮助用户和开发者了解软件的质量和性能。通过构建一个合理的打分体系,可以充分发挥打分制的优势,提高软件评估的准确性和可靠性。
